Swimming Lesson Requirements
In order to enter a level, the child must be able to complete all skills in the preceding level.
Water Exploration • Fully submerge face for 3 seconds • 10 bounces in chest deep water • Bob to chin level with support • Float supported on front • Float supported on back • Blow bubbles • Enter and exit pool alone • Kick supported on back • Kick supported on front • Walk 5 yards alternating arms • Discuss basic water safety rules • Become familiar with getting help • Reaching assists without equipment |
Primary Skills • Fully submerge face for 3 seconds • Retrieve objects in chest deep water • Retrieve objects while suspended • Explore deep water with support • Prone glide, float, and recovery for 5 seconds • Supine glide, float and recovery for 5 seconds • Leveling off from vertical float • Rhythmic breathing while bobbing (10 times) • Recovery from chest deep water into vertical float • Flutter kick on front (support optional) • Flutter kick on back (support optional) • Finning on back • Back crawl arm action • Combined stroke on front for 5 yards • Combined stroke on back for 5 yards • Turning over – front to back • Turning over – back to front • Assist non-swimmer to feet |
Stroke Readiness • Retrieve chest-deep object with eyes open • Retrieve suspended object with eyes open • Explore deep water with support • Bob with head under 15 times in chest-deep water • Jump into deep water • Dive from dock • Prone glide two body lengths • Supine glide two body lengths • Front crawl 10 yards breathing front or side • Coordinated back crawl 10 yards • Elementary backstroke kick 10 yards • Reverse direction while swimming on front • Reverse direction while swimming on back • Tread water • Learn safe diving rules |
Stroke Development • Deep water bobbing • Experiment with buoyancy and floating positions • Rotary breathing • Standing front dive • Elementary backstroke 10 yards • Sculling on back 5 yards or 15 seconds • Front crawl 25 yards with rotary breathing • Back crawl 25 yards • Breaststroke kick 10 yards with or without support • Sidestroke kick 10 yards with or without support • Tread water 2 minutes with any kick |
Stroke Development • Alternate breathing • Stride jump entry • Long shallow dive • Breaststroke 10 yards • Sidestroke 10 yards • Swim under water 3 body lengths • Elementary backstroke 25 yards • Back crawl 50 yards • Dolphin kick 10 yards • Front crawl 50 yards • Open turn on front |
Stroke Proficiency • Front crawl 100 yards with one turn • Back crawl 100 yards with one turn • Breaststroke 25 yards • Butterfly 10 yards • Approach stroke 10 yards • Breaststroke turn • Sidestroke turn • Speed turn for breaststroke • Flip turn front crawl • Pike surface dive • Tuck surface dive • Tread water for 3 minutes, one minute without hands • Throwing rescue • Roll spinal injury face up |
